Transaction 21fa5abee4f0e53fae8a4ef26cfb8fc8a73c80eae581b7ab97d5c67edbccb7c0

1 Input
2 Outputs
  • 21fa5abee4f0e53fae8a4ef26cfb8fc8a73c80eae581b7ab97d5c67edbccb7c0:0
  • value  718133
    address  1LUJazjLV4xzJo3JScbmv3duUrYXqa4qJA
  • 21fa5abee4f0e53fae8a4ef26cfb8fc8a73c80eae581b7ab97d5c67edbccb7c0:1
  • value  21667962
    address  3LCgBqE2XqJtKFf3JcF4Qb3xMaTXbT5LBw